Description du poste:

Job Description:The Child Life Assistant Interacts directly with pediatric patients, families, and other healthcare team members and facilitates age-appropriate activities to help make the healthcare experience easier for patients and families. Under the direction of a child life specialist, the child life assistant provides activities in a play setting that reduces patient and family distress, increases effective patient and family coping, fosters patient independence, and promotes optimum development. This role is designed as a career path toward other child development roles and most Child Life Assistants are working towards child life certification through the Association of Child Life Professionals while earning a degree and certifications.

Essential Functions

* Accurately assesses and prioritizes developmental needs of the pediatric patient and family and updates child life specialist when patient needs are outside scope of practice.

* Develops, implements, advertises, and evaluates developmentally appropriate play/recreational activities and directs parents, students, and volunteers in providing developmentally appropriate toys to patients and families in play space.

* Screens and transports patients to play areas, completes appropriate check-in guidelines and policies to ensure child safety and assists in coordinating special events, holidays, and special visitors. 

* Maintains a clean, safe environment in accordance with infection prevention and safety standards.

* Monitors and provides a supportive child-friendly environment in play spaces; supervises, orients, and trains students and volunteers as needed. 

* Assists with ordering, receiving, organizing, and distributing supplies.

* Supervises and independently leads the facility "Kids Clubhouse," coordinating the work of the volunteers in those spaces.
